Boxing under the name Jack Brazzo, Palance reportedly compiled a record of 15 consecutive victories with 12 knockouts before losing a close decision to future heavyweight contender Joe Baksi in a Pier-6 brawl (a colloquial term meaning an unsanctioned and particularly rough fight). When not traveling to movie sets or on location with Ripleys Believe It or Not, a TV show Palance hosted in the early 80s, the couple split time between a home in Pennsylvania near Palances birthplace of Hazelton, and a 1,200-acre ranch in Tehachapi, California, which did indeed have a huge red barn, along with a healthy herd of Hereford cattle and a menagerie of dogs, cats, chickens, peacocks, rabbits and horses.
